a.

To determine:

The interpretation of the given experiment about the heritability of docile behavior in foxes.

Introduction:

It is given that an experiment of breeding silver foxes for tameness was started by a geneticist. He began with wild foxes, and select the progeny which showed the least afraid and aggressive towards humans for further reproduction.

b.

To determine:

Whether the domestication phenotype of silver foxes means that the same genes control both the behavior and appearance.

Introduction:

It is given that silver foxes exhibit morphological changes along with the behavioral changes. They developed spotted coats, floppy ears, and curly tails.

A mountain region has a population of 5,000 mountain goats. You score these animals for the R locus and find that this locus has two alleles, R (dominant) and r (recessive). 3200 individuals are homozygous dominant, 1,600 are heterozygous, and 200 are homozygous recessive.  a) Calculate the allele frequencies for this population. Show your work.       b) Calculate the observed genotypic frequencies for this population. Show your work.         c) Calculate the expected genotype frequencies if the population is in Hardy-Weinberg equilibrium. Show your work.         d) Does this population appear to be at H-W equilibrium? Why or why not? (You do not need to analyze this statistically).
